It appears you have a non-code-signing certificate (

https://www.wapt.fr/fr/doc/wapt-configu ... -with-wapt).

Marking it as Code-Signing defines whether the certificate/key pair will be authorized to sign software packages.

The package you are importing is a software package with a setup.py file, so it is not authorized.

Just to clarify, "Tag as Code Signing" is necessary to sign software packages. The "Tag as CA Certitiface" part is there to create a root certificate from which child certificates can then be created. But this isn't necessary in the vast majority of cases.
